- ....,.`.., ti1Vu�l�lu�iiVti�l�lsiil�i.l�iJ.1GJ:��1.lialf2ftft4LaLffa:.SL�:l:ll:) :1Lf�f :.t2]. <br />Page #2 - North Olmsted Civil Service Commission - 8/20/87 <br />Continuation of regular meeting. <br />OLD BUSINESS: <br />Commissioners elected to go into executive session to discuss and eye <br />problem of an entry level patrolman candidate. Chief Marsh was invited <br />into the discussions. <br />Meeting resumed 4:35 P.M. <br />A meeting between commissioners, Mr. Tom Stroh and Mr. Bob Wendt with <br />the North Olmsted City School personnel, Mr. James Kline and Mr. Len <br />Frick re the up -coming mechanic test was discussed. It was the feeling <br />of both commissioners and the board that this test could be accomplished <br />"in-house" and the commission informed as to procedures and results of <br />this.examination. <br />CITY CLERK TEST: <br />Results of the City Clerk test were submitted. Three candidates were <br />brought forward from the former active certified list and their grades <br />were computed, by the testing company., into the new ranked list of <br />candidates. Nine candidates took the written examination on June 30, <br />1987 and six appeared for thetyping test on August 12th. Those not. <br />appearing were removed from the active candidate list. Final results of <br />this test: 3 candidates exempt; 3 passed the examination and 3 failed <br />the testing. Letters of "Intent" were mailed.to the passing six <br />candidates alerting them of a present job opening and their desire of an <br />interview. One candidates.requested her name be removed from the active <br />list, three were not interested at this time and two.declared interest <br />in the interview.process-. Names of the interested candidates will be <br />forwarded to the mayor. <br />NEW BUSINESS: <br />Discussion on a letter on behalf of the employee at the Senior Center <br />from Far Vest was discussed. Letter forwarded to the Far Vest advising <br />them that a candidate has to pass an examination before consideration of <br />the commission can be given. This fact was reinforced by the law <br />director in his letter of August 14, 1987. <br />MEETING OF COMMISSIONERS WITH MAYOR PETRIGAC: <br />Commissioners met with the mayor to discuss. the relocation of the office <br />of civil service during the renovation of the -Town Hall. It was felt <br />that, with the permission of the Clerk of Council, Florence Campbell, :'we <br />might -be sable to use the extra desk in her office. <br />
